A DEEPER WAY OF WORKING

Your experience may feel complicated.

I draw from evidence-based practice in perinatal mental health and Internal Family Systems (IFS) to help you understand the different thoughts, feelings, and impulses that can emerge during pregnancy and motherhood. As we slow down, notice patterns, and make connections, you can begin to relate to these parts differently and develop greater trust in your own inner guidance.
